Stan Kroenke has a keen eye for quality. Maybe that’s why in addition to Screaming Eagle he also owns Jonata in the Santa Ynez Valley! Jonata (pronounced “ho-nada”) has proven that Bordeaux and Rhône varieties can succeed in the warm pockets of Santa Ynez. Made from the vineyard blocks that are either too young or don’t fit into the vintage style of the Jonata wines, The Paring is essentially a “chip off the old block.” Jonata winemaker Matt Dees crafts this spectacular wine and The Paring wines bring an incredible value to your diner table! A blend of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Petit Verdot, Cabernet Franc, Syrah and Grenache aged in 55% new French oak for 22 months, the wine shows mint, cedar, cassis, blackberry and ripe plum flavors, with good structure and richness.
